Currently, Meccha Chameleon is a breakout PC game available on Steam. It runs on Windows and supports both keyboard/mouse and controllers.

Console & Mac Status:

  • PS5 / Xbox: No official release yet. Console ports have been teased by developer Lemorion but remain TBD.
  • Mac / macOS: Not supported at launch. A macOS build has not been confirmed.

For now, the only official way to play is through Steam on a Windows PC.
